Cessna 210 Series Aeroplanes
AD/CESSNA 210/42 Fuel Flow Indication System - Hose
Inspection and Replacement
11/79
Applicability: Models 210L and T210L with S/Nos. 21061040 and subsequent Models 210M, T210M and P210N modified to incorporate Symbolic Displays Inc. fuel flow indicating system per STC.SA3835WE.
Requirement: 1. Inspect the fuel flow transducer installation on the upper left side of the engine adjacent to the fuel distributor manifold.
2. If an NAS 424-4 coupling is installed between transducer and distributor manifold, remove coupling and replace with either hose assembly Aeroquip P/No. AE7010001E0040 or Stratoflex P/No. 111D417-45-0040.
Note: FAA AD 79-19-06 Amendment 39-3558 also refers to this subject.
Compliance: Within 25 hours time in service after 3 October 1979.
Background: The hose assembly connecting the fuel flow transducer with the fuel distributor manifold has proved unsuitable in service and may leak fuel over the engine.
